Hello, > Là ça fonctionne ;)
Houbadi, on dirais que j'avais raison d'insister ;). > Par contre : > /transfert/create/reserve/service/1511 ne fonctionne pas du tout. J'ai la > réponse ci-dessous. transfert_create PUT /transfert/ create/:source/:cible C'est normal ca ne matche pas le pattern ci-dessus, si ton item est obligatoire, mets le dans le pattern de la route ? /transfert/create/:source/:cible/:item > Et je ne vois pas avec quelle(s) autre(s) route(s) il pourrait y avoir > conflit. Cf ci-dessus. > Merci pour ton aide NP. Tonio. > > > -----Message d'origine----- > > De : symfony-fr@googlegroups.com > > [mailto:symfony...@googlegroups.com] De la part de Tonio > > Envoyé : mardi 24 février 2009 13:25 > > À : Symfony-fr > > Objet : [symfony-fr] Re: Routing et erreur empty module > > and/or action after parsing the URL > > > /transfert/create/reserve/service?item=1511&sf_method=PUT > > > Faute de réponse à ma question, je persiste ... ;) > > > On Feb 24, 11:07 am, Mailing-list Lélio <mailing-l...@lelio.fr> wrote: > > > De plus lorsque je décommente la route default pour l'activer, Je > > > tombe bien sur une page sans erreur mais dans la SfToolbar > > > config, > > > je vois que la route > > > /transfert/create/reserve/service?item=1511 > > > > Est interprétée : > > > parameterHolder: > > > action: create > > > item: '1511' > > > module: transfert > > > reserve: service > > > transfert: { id: '', _csrf_token: > > 1151e58e0d6e1e68d698861bcf2dc58d, > > > type_transfert_id: '50', item_id: '1511', stock_source_id: '49', > > > stock_cible_id: '50', quantite_demandee: '', quantite_autorisee: '', > > > date_prevue: { day: '', month: '', year: '' } } > > > attributeHolder: > > > sf_route: 'sfRoute Object()' > > > > C'est donc malheureusement la route default qui est bien prise en > > > compte :( > > > > > -----Message d'origine----- > > > > De : symfony-fr@googlegroups.com > > > > [mailto:symfony...@googlegroups.com] De la part de Mailing-list > > > > Lélio Envoyé : mardi 24 février 2009 09:28 À : > > > > symfony-fr@googlegroups.com Objet : [symfony-fr] Re: Routing et > > > > erreur empty module and/or action after parsing the URL > > > > > Hé bien simplement l'erreur suivante. > > > > Empty module and/or action after parsing the URL > > "/transfert/create" > > > > (/) > > > > > J'avoue que je suis un peu perdu :/ > > > > > Merci en tout cas pour l'aide et le soutien. Ça m'aide à tenir > > > > > > -----Message d'origine----- > > > > > De : symfony-fr@googlegroups.com > > > > > [mailto:symfony...@googlegroups.com] De la part de > > lionel chanson > > > > > Envoyé : lundi 23 février 2009 20:47 À : > > > > symfony-fr@googlegroups.com > > > > > Objet : [symfony-fr] Re: Routing et erreur empty module > > > > and/or action > > > > > after parsing the URL > > > > > > Ok et si tu fais main_dev.php/transfert/create ( en laissant > > > > > defaut commentée ) ? > > > > > > ++ > > > > > > Le 23 février 2009 14:21, Mailing-list Lélio > > > > <mailing-l...@lelio.fr> a > > > > > écrit : > > > > > > > En fait, peut-être que je m'y prends mal dès le début. > > > > > > Je vais dire quel est mon besoin et peut-être pourrez-vous > > > > > m'orienter. > > > > > > > J'ai un transfert. Lorsque je veux en créer un nouveau, > > > > je souhaite > > > > > > que dans l'url apparaissent la source et la cible afin de les > > > > > > répercuter dans l'objet créé. De même avec l'item qui est > > > > transféré. > > > > > > Ainsi je n'ai que 2 champs : la quantité + la date prévue. > > > > > > J'aimerais que la source, la cible et l'item soit > > > > > > automatiquement gérés sans action humaine possible. > > > > > > > Merci d'avance > > > > > > >> -----Message d'origine----- > > > > > >> De : symfony-fr@googlegroups.com > > > > > >> [mailto:symfony...@googlegroups.com] De la part de Tonio > > > > Envoyé : > > > > > >> lundi 23 février 2009 14:10 À : Symfony-fr Objet : > > > > > [symfony-fr] Re: > > > > > >> Routing et erreur empty module and/or action after > > > > parsing the URL > > > > > > >> 'lut, > > > > > > >> Donc comment testes tu ta route ? > > > > > >> Est tu sûr que ta requete est un PUT ? > > > > > > >> Tonio > > > > > > >> On Feb 23, 2:08 pm, Mailing-list Lélio > > > > > <mailing-l...@lelio.fr> wrote: > > > > > >> > Justement, la route default est en commentaire. > > > > > >> > Ça passe quand elle est décommentée. > > > > > > >> > Voici les log (default invalidée) : > > > > > >> > =================================== >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} Connect > > > > > >> sfRoute "homepage" > > > > > >> > (/)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} Connect > > > > > >> sfRoute "item" > > > > > >> > (/item)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} Connect > > > > > >> > sfPropelRoute "item_new" (/item/new) Feb 23 14:03:45 > > > >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fPropelRoute "item_create" > > > > > >> (/item/create)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} Connect > > > > > >> > sfPropelRoute "item_show" (/item/show/:id) Feb 23 > > > > > 14:03:45 symfony > > > > > >> > [info] {sfPatternRouting} Connect sfPropelRoute "item_edit" > > > > > >> > (/item/edit/:id) Feb 23 14:03:45 symfony [info] > > > > > {sfPatternRouting} > > > > > >> > Connect sfPropelRoute "item_update" (/item/update/:id) Feb > > > > > >> 23 14:03:45 > > > > > >> > symfony [info] {sfPatternRouting} Connect sfPropelRoute > > > > > >> "item_delete" > > > > > >> > (/item/delete/:id/*) Feb 23 14:03:45 symfony [info] > > > > > >> {sfPatternRouting} > > > > > >> > Connect sfRoute "item_search" (/search) Feb 23 14:03:45 > > > > > >> sym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ute "file_upload" > > > > > >> (/file/upload/:item)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} Connect > > > > > >> > sfPropelRoute "stock" (/stock) Feb 23 14:03:45 >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fPropelRoute "stock_show" > > > > > >> > (/stock/show/:slug) Feb 23 14:03:45 symfony [info] > > > > > >> {sfPatternRouting} > > > > > >> > Connect sfRoute "transfert_attendus_service" > > > > > >> > (/transfert/list_attendus_ss) Feb 23 14:03:45 >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ute > > "transfert_attendus_reserve" > > > > > >> > (/transfert/list_attendus_sr) Feb 23 14:03:45 >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ute "transfert_entree_ss" > > > > > >> (/transfert)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} > > > > > Connect sfRoute > > > > > >> > "transfert_entree_sr" (/transfert/entree_sr) Feb 23 > > > > > >> 14:03:45 symfony > > > > > >> > [info] {sfPatternRouting} Connect sfRoute > > > > > >> "transfert_reserve_service" > > > > > >> > (/transfert/reserve/service) Feb 23 14:03:45 >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ute > > > > "transfert_service_proximite" > > > > > >> > (/transfert/service/proximite) Feb 23 14:03:45 >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ute > > > > > "transfert_new_reserve_service" > > > > > >> > (/transfert/new/reserve/service/:item)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} > > > > > Connect sfRoute > > > > > >> > "transfert_new_service_proximite" > > > > > >> > (/transfert/new/service/proximite)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} Connect > > > > > >> > sfPropelRoute "transfert_show" (/transfert/show/:id) Feb 23 > > > > > >> 14:03:45 > > > > > >> > symfony [info] {sfPatternRouting} Connect sfPropelRoute > > > > > >> > "transfert_create" (/transfert/create/:source/:cible) > > > > > >> > Feb 23 14:03:45 symfony [info] {sfPatternRouting} Connect > > > > > >> > sfPropelRoute "transfert_edit" (/transfert/edit/:id) Feb 23 > > > > > >> 14:03:45 > > > > > >> > symfony [info] {sfPatternRouting} Connect sfPropelRoute > > > > > >> > "transfert_update" (/transfert/update/:id) Feb 23 > > > > > 14:03:45 symfony > > > > > >> > [info] {sfPatternRouting} Connect sfPropelRoute > > > > > "transfert_delete" > > > > > >> > (/transfert/delete/:id) Feb 23 14:03:45 sym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ute "sf_guard_signin" > > > > > >> (/login) Feb 23 > > > > > >> > 14:03:45 symfony [info] {sfPatternRouting} Connect sfRoute > > > > > >> > "sf_guard_signout" (/logout) Feb 23 14:03:45 >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ute "sf_guard_signin" > > > > > >> (/login) Feb 23 > > > > > >> > 14:03:45 symfony [info] {sfPatternRouting} Connect sfRoute > > > > > >> > "sf_guard_signout" (/logout) Feb 23 14:03:45 > > symfony [info] > > > > > >> > {sfPatternRouting} Connect sfRoute "sf_guard_password" > > > > > >> > (/request_password) Feb 23 14:03:45 symfony [err] > > > > > >> > {sfError404Exception} Empty module and/or action after > > > > > >> parsing the URL > > > > > >> > "/transfert/create/reserve/service" (/). > > > > > >> > Feb 23 14:03:45 symfony [err] {sfError404Exception} 3 > > > > > >> > =================== > > > > > > >> > Et lorsque j'appelle ./symfony app:routes elle y est : > > > > > >> > ===============================>> app Current routes > > > > > >> for application "main" > > > > > > >> > Name Method > > > > Pattern > > > > > >> > sf_guard_password ANY /request_password > > > > > >> > sf_guard_signout ANY /logout > > > > > >> sf_guard_signin > > > > > >> > ANY /login homepage ANY / item > > > > > > >> > ANY /item item_new ANY > > /item/new > > > > > >> > item_create PUT /item/create > > > > > >> item_show > > > > > >> > GET /item/show/:id item_edit GET > > ... > > read more » --~--~---------~--~----~------------~-------~--~----~ Vous avez reçu ce message, car vous êtes abonné au groupe Groupe "Symfony-fr" de Google Groupes. Pour transmettre des messages à ce groupe, envoyez un e-mail à l'adresse symfony-fr@googlegroups.com Pour résilier votre abonnement à ce groupe, envoyez un e-mail à l'adresse symfony-fr+unsubscr...@googlegroups.com Pour afficher d'autres options, visitez ce groupe à l'adresse http://groups.google.com/group/symfony-fr?hl=fr -~----------~----~----~----~------~----~------~--~---